Output c7da58c4e04308f2d26b33ca93ad63ee818a5c372b0c9c51232ddb476bffdfee:30

value
35844863
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43a22078e6e54d6bafd9e296508a9c5876f6ab39 OP_EQUAL
address
ME4mj44BwyFn5Etnu3zEoU84hX5sS3rUUv
transaction
c7da58c4e04308f2d26b33ca93ad63ee818a5c372b0c9c51232ddb476bffdfee
spent
true